The updateable clustered columnstore in Microsoft SQL Server 2016 offers a leading solution for your data warehouse workload with order of magnitude better data compression and query performance over traditional B-Tree based schemas. This session assumes that you understand columnstore technology basics. We will do a deep dive into (a) strategies to load data leveraging minimal logging with concurrency (b) identifying/solving performance issues with queries (c) real-world best practices of keeping columnstore humming along.

Presenter Sunil Agarwal is a seasoned professional with 30+ years of industry experience in databases, Sunil has worked as a developer/lead in the relational database engine technology, a tool designer/lead building backup/restore tools, and as an application developer/manager enabling B2B commerce and e-learning. He has been in his role as a Principal Program Manager for SQL Server for the last 12+ years. Sunil has authored many technical white papers/blogs and has co-authored two books in SQL Server and presented database technologies in numerous national/international conferences. He enjoys teaching and has taught introductory programming courses at the University of Rhode Island and the University of Colorado.
